What is a Tripod Turnstile Gate?
A Tripod Turnstile Gate is a waist-high pedestrian access control solution designed to restrict passage to one person at a time. As the name suggests, it utilizes a three-arm rotating mechanism. When an authorized user presents a credential (such as an RFID card, fingerprint, or QR code), the locking mechanism releases, allowing the arms to rotate 120 degrees to let a single person pass.
These gates are the most widely used type of turnstile globally due to their robust mechanical design and ability to handle high volumes of foot traffic without occupying a large footprint. They serve as a physical deterrent to unauthorized entry while maintaining a smooth flow of authorized personnel.
Key Features & Technical Specifications
Modern tripod turnstiles are engineered for performance and longevity. When evaluating a Tripod Turnstile Gate for your premises, look for these essential features:
-
Robust Construction: The body is typically crafted from AISI 304 or 316 grade stainless steel. This provides exceptional resistance to rust, dust, and rain, making the gates suitable for both indoor and outdoor environments.
-
Intelligent “Drop Arm” Mechanism: Safety is paramount. In the event of a power failure or fire emergency, the horizontal arm automatically drops down to create a clear, obstacle-free exit route, complying with international fire safety norms.
-
Bi-Directional Passage: Most systems allow for programmable passage directions. You can set the gate to be uni-directional (entry only) or bi-directional (entry and exit) depending on the time of day or specific operational needs.
-
Seamless Integration: These gates are designed to be “brain-agnostic,” meaning they can easily integrate with third-party systems including Biometric devices (fingerprint/face recognition), RFID readers, Barcode/QR scanners, and Time & Attendance software.
-
High Throughput: A standard tripod turnstile can handle a passage rate of approximately 30 persons per minute, ensuring that queues do not build up during peak hours.
Top Benefits of Installing Tripod Turnstiles
investing in a tripod turnstile system offers immediate operational advantages:
1. Enhanced Security & Tailgating Prevention
The primary function of any access control barrier is security. The three-arm design physically forces single-file passage. This significantly reduces “tailgating”—where an unauthorized person follows closely behind an authorized user to sneak in. For facilities requiring strict headcount accuracy, this feature is indispensable.
2. Cost-Effective Crowd Management
Compared to optical speed gates or full-height turnstiles, tripod turnstiles are a budget-friendly option. They provide a high level of security functionality at a fraction of the cost, making them ideal for budget-conscious projects that cannot compromise on safety.
3. Space-Saving Design
Real estate in lobby areas is often limited. Tripod turnstiles have a compact vertical or bridge-style housing that fits easily into narrow corridors or small reception areas where larger gates would be impractical.
4. Durability and Low Maintenance
Designed for millions of cycles, the electromechanical drive mechanisms are built to withstand heavy abuse. The stainless steel finish requires minimal cleaning to maintain its professional appearance, even in high-traffic zones like railway stations.

Common Applications & Use Cases
The versatility of the Tripod Turnstile Gate makes it a staple across various industries:
-
Corporate Offices & Tech Parks: To track employee attendance and restrict access to non-staff members.
-
Public Transport (Metro & Bus Stations): For automated fare collection (AFC) and managing the rush of commuters.
-
Educational Institutions: Colleges and universities use them to secure libraries, hostels, and campus entrances.
-
Recreational Facilities: Gyms, theme parks, and stadiums rely on them for ticket validation and membership verification.
-
Industrial Factories: To manage shift timings and prevent unauthorized access to hazardous floor areas.
How to Choose the Right Tripod Turnstile
Selecting the right gate involves more than just picking the lowest price. Consider the following factors to ensure SEO-friendly long-term value:
-
Traffic Volume: Estimate the peak flow of people. If you have thousands of staff entering in a 15-minute window, you may need multiple lanes.
-
Environment: For outdoor installation, ensure the unit has an IP54 or higher protection rating to withstand rain and dust.
-
Integration Needs: Ensure the turnstile controller board is compatible with your existing access control hardware (e.g., if you already use HID cards).
-
Aesthetics: For premium lobbies, consider “Bridge Type” tripods which offer a sleeker look compared to the purely functional “Vertical Type” tripods.

1. What happens to the tripod turnstile gate during a power failure or emergency? Safety is a primary feature of modern tripod turnstiles. Most systems come equipped with a “drop-arm” mechanism. In the event of a power outage or a fire alarm trigger, the horizontal arm automatically drops down to create a completely open passage. This ensures rapid and unhindered evacuation, complying with fire safety and emergency exit regulations.
2. Can tripod turnstiles be installed outdoors? Yes, they can. However, it is crucial to choose a model manufactured with high-grade stainless steel (AISI 304 or 316) to prevent rusting. Additionally, the unit should have an IP rating (usually IP54 or higher) to ensure the internal electronics are protected against rain, dust, and humidity. For outdoor installations, adding a canopy overhead is also recommended for extra longevity.
3. Is it possible to integrate biometric or RFID systems with the turnstile? Absolutely. Tripod turnstiles are designed to be compatible with a wide range of third-party access control systems. You can easily integrate RFID card readers, fingerprint scanners, facial recognition devices, QR code scanners, and even coin acceptors. They serve as the physical barrier while your preferred software handles the verification.
4. What is the difference between a Vertical and a Bridge-type tripod turnstile? The main difference lies in the housing design and aesthetics.
-
Vertical Tripod Turnstiles have a compact, pillar-like shape and a smaller footprint, making them ideal for tight spaces.
-
Bridge-type Tripod Turnstiles have a longer, rectangular housing that looks more substantial. They offer more internal space for mounting access control devices and are often preferred for corporate lobbies where aesthetics are a priority.
5. How many people can pass through a tripod turnstile per minute? A standard tripod turnstile offers a throughput rate of approximately 30 to 35 persons per minute. This speed is sufficient for most medium-traffic environments like offices, gyms, and cafeterias. For extremely high-traffic areas like busy metro stations, you might consider multiple lanes to prevent queuing.
